RUSSIAN LIPS

Russian lips is the latest technique used to inject dermal fillers. Unlike traditional lip fillers, the Russian lip technique involves injecting tiny droplets of dermal filler into the lips, mainly focused around the centre to achieve their signature, heart-shaped look.

​

The filler is injected vertically into multiple injection points and dragged upwards from the base to the top of the lip line, rather than horizontally with traditional lip fillers. Russian lips are larger in heigh rather than volume, which diminishes the duck like appearance and creates a more natural looking result.

CHEEK FILLER

Dermal filler can be injected into the cheek area to provide more definition and highlight the cheekbones.

​

Cheeks are the area of the face that tend to experience volume loss with age, becoming hollow as the fat pads move south. Injecting filler can restore volume and provide a more youthful appearance, whilst also lifting the mid facial area.

​

Dermal filler is hyaluronic acid, which naturally occurs in our skin meaning the treatment risk is minimal. It also promotes skin hydration by attracting water and is specially formulated to inject deep into the skin to add natural volume.

NASOLABIAL FOLDS

Often referred to as smile lines, nasolabial folds are the lines seen from the sides of the nose to the corners of the mouth. These creases become more noticeable as part of the natural ageing process. Fat is lost from the cheeks, reducing skin volume and making these folds appear deeper. Smiling naturally causes a deeper crease in this area also.

​

This area is easily corrected with filler to restore lost volume and soften the appearance of these creases, resulting in a softer, youthful, yet natural look to the face.

MARIONETTE LINES

Marionette lines are the lines below each corner of the mouth that can significantly add age to your face. The name is derives from Marionette Puppets, that have faces with long vertical creases. These creases give a grim or sad look to the face and occur with age, smoking and genetics can progress to form jowls later on.

​

It is possible to life these corners with dermal filler by adding volume and anchoring the corners higher up, helping to restore balance with the rest of the face.

CHIN FILLER

Dermal fillers in the chin can be used to enhance the overall appearance of the chin area. It helps to reduce a weak chin and smooth out irregularities through increasing volume to the area.

​

Anyone with a short, weak chin can benefit from this treatment. Females can benefit from this treatment to create a longer, more feminine, heart-shaped face, resulting in a more balanced profile. Patients with a chin dimple can also benefit from chin filler to help eliminate this.

JAW FILLER

Dermal fillers in the jawline can help to define and strengthen the area. As we age, the jawline weakens. This is caused by volume loss as our natural muscle and bone mass reduces. Injecting dermal filler to the jawline will help stiffen the skin and define the chin and jowl area, resulting in a sharper jawline.

ANTI-WRINKLE

Anti-wrinkle product can be used to help freeze the movement of muscles in our foreheads. This movement leads to permanent wrinkles and lines which in turn can make us look older. Anti-wrinkle injections can be used as a preventative measure, stopping lines from forming or it can be used to soften deep existing lines.​

​

Anti-wrinkle product can also be injected into the masseter muscle to slim the jawline.

SKIN BOOSTERS

Profhilo is an injectable skin boosting rejuvenation treatment. Unlike fillers and botox, it is not designed to add volume in the face or restrict movement in the facial muscles. This anti-ageing hydration treatment contains high levels or hyaluronic acid which penetrates through the skin to activate the production of collagen, creating plumper skin. Skin boosters work across the entire face rather than focusing on one area and are therefore great for smoothing fine lines and wrinkles, achieving a more youthful appearance.

AQUALYX™ FAT DISSOLVING

Aqualyx™ is used for the dissolution of fat deposits. It works by breaking down fat in a controlled way so that your body can safely remove it through it’s lymphatic system. Typically, Aqualyx™ required a course of two to four treatments with four to six week intervals between each session. Although the treatment doesn’t hurt, you should expect some swelling which can take up to three weeks to subside. Although the fat doesn’t come back, Aqualyx™ should only be used as a supplement to a healthy lifestyle, and is only intended for dealing with small pockets of fat rather than providing a complete weight loss solution
